Everyone is trading AI.

Almost nobody can draw the power stack underneath it.

Here’s the map.

The stack

GPUs / accelerators

AI infrastructure & neoclouds

Data centers

Utilities / grid

Nuclear + uranium

Cooling, electrical gear, power systems

Why this map matters more than another NVDA take

AlphaOS currently tags AI Infrastructure as Peak cycle — high growth (median revenue growth in the thesis is extreme), strong demand, but with valuation/competition risk.

Nuclear is tagged Recovery.

That split matters:

  • Chip/infra = crowded, priced for perfection
  • Power/nuclear = earlier in the recognition curve

Same megatrend. Different entry points on the stack.

Bottom line

AI is a semiconductor story on the surface.

Underneath, it’s:

chips → clusters → buildings → electrons → uranium → transformers and cooling.

If you only own GPUs, you own one layer of a five-layer machine.
